My analysis
The San Francisco Giants trot out ace Logan Webb on Tuesday. The 27-year-old has been lights out at home in his career, posting a 25-16 record, 2.70 ERA, and 1.13 WHIP across 343 2/3 innings. That’s a huge sample size and he’s been remarkably consistent. 

He faces a New York Mets lineup that has gone ice-cold across the last two games. Falling back to Earth following a six-game winning streak, they've scored just two runs in their past two games with more strikeouts (17) than hits (11). One has to like Webb’s outlook on Tuesday night in the Bay. 

New York counters with veteran right-hander Luis Severino, who has bounced back from a disastrous 2023 season thus far by lowering his ERA from 6.65 to 2.14. Is the newfound success sustainable? 

His ERA finished above 3.40 just once from 2015 to 2022, so it’s possible. However, I’m worried his effectiveness is only temporary due to his inability to make batters miss. His 7.8% swinging strike rate is as poor as it gets and is well below his career average of 11.4%. Until that number stabilizes, I'll bet on regression.

I like the home team to come away with a victory considering Webb has been fantastic at home in his career and the Mets are regressing quickly after a recent hot stretch.

The opening number was bet down from -155 to -130, and I’m a buyer at that price. Some books moved down as far as -120 before seeing some buyback, and I think buying the dip is the correct move.

Webb isn’t known as a huge strikeout pitcher, but he’s notched five punchouts in three of his five starts this season. The Mets are in the habit of swinging and missing recently — the last two starting pitchers (Tyler Glasnow and Keaton Winn) they faced combined for 16 strikeouts. 

Michael Conforto looked fired up to play against his former team, going 2-for-4 with a home run in Game 1. He’s recorded a hit in three straight games and I’ll take him to continue swinging the sticks well against Severino, who ranks in the 20th percentile in hard-hit rate, 23rd percentile in whiff rate, and 15th percentile in offspeed run value.
